Output ad603398228dfaf03c52f1268e09017f4a150fa786af5b5a409e5ff08e41b335:6

value
50050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70f58684eb38c16332664e3c871e4ddfb446c9c8 OP_EQUALVERIFY OP_CHECKSIG
address
1BJGotpWhFqbTcQ92UeqM3Hug7hd7aFjcK
transaction
ad603398228dfaf03c52f1268e09017f4a150fa786af5b5a409e5ff08e41b335
spent
true